Big numbers again from Lachie Hicks who can find a stack of it when he's in the mood to dominate. He had some longer stints in the forward line as the game progressed and looked dangerous down there, flying for his marks and kicking four goals for the game. Hicks can cough the ball up under pressure and his disposal early wasn't great but overall, this was a strong performance in a big win for his team.

the big thing for me is that if we try and be cute, getting a pick in before a bid + 2 picks to match these club ties will become tricky.

With the DVI set to stay the same and not adjust with the Tassie picks included in the order, it's set to seriously f*** with any chance we have of getting additional players in imho.

FWIW, Bewick could be a top 5 pick, we simply should just use the top 5 pick on him rather than trying to get a pick at 4 + another first rounder to match on him.

I think more clubs will simply just take their own club tied players or pass on them with a natural selection they own. That way they aren't using two picks to match unless they slide down and are very good value for the bid they attract.
